Eat Healthy Food!
Food that contains tryptophan (an amino acid that helps calm the brain) increases the body’s ability to control negative moods. These types of food (such as cheese, bananas, turkey and yogurt) elevate serotonin levels, and make you feel serene and happy. It’s like eating half a kilo of chocolate at once… only you don’t. Get some physical contact!
The caressing, hugging and physical contact in general drive the brain to release chemicals such as serotonin and dopamine. It’s funny, I know, but it’s true, as it lowers the level of cortisol, the stress hormone, and reduces tension. Hug your boyfriend, a friend, a pet… always working! My poor two kitties know best!
